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cambodian Striped Squirrel | Mottled Marble |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(동물) | Animalia (동물) |
| Phylum | Chordata (척삭동물) | Arthropoda (절지동물) |
| Class | Mammalia (포유류) | Insecta (곤충) |
| Order | Rodentia (설치류) | Lepidoptera (나비목)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Tortricidae |
| Genus | Tamiops | Bactra |
| Species | Tamiops rodolphii | Bactra furfurana |
